Flux Resources is seeking a CIS Developer to join one of our clients in Portland Oregon. This is a full-time direct-hire opportunity. This opportunity is open to a hybrid schedule. Base salary range: $86,500.00 - $123,250.00 (Level 2) or $96,000.00 - $136,800.00 (Level 3) per year, depending on qualifications The Role This opportunity will be responsible for development, technical configuration and application administration of Customer Information System (CIS) system and associated 3rd party tools. This position will work closely with the IT management team, business analysts, and IT&S development teams to ensure that the CIS solution effectively supports the business needs. Day To Day Develop, test, build, deploy, troubleshoot and maintain the overall CIS solution Demonstrate strong requirements gathering skills by working with the business analysts to perform gap-analyses and document functional and technical specifications for enhancements as well as integrations with other business applications. Drive the effective transition of requirements to successful solution delivery by ensuring a clear and complete understanding of the requirements and providing accurate work estimates that improve sequencing and prioritization of work. Test modifications for validity of results, accuracy, reliability and conformance to established standards through conducting unit testing participating in system and user acceptance testing. Collaborate with other developers to expand the functional and technical knowledge and expertise within the team. Participate in code reviews, maintaining consistent application standards Participate in the complete software development lifecycle using iterative methodologies Monitor key metrics and system health, quickly identifying and resolving problems Support Company’s commitment to a culture of safe work practices. Required Come on your first day with: Bachelor's degree in computer science, system analysis or a related study, or equivalent experience Minimum of 3 years of design, development, and implementation experience in information technology and systems. Additional years’ experience required for level 3. Working technical knowledge of applications and network design, application development, application programming interfaces (APIs), middleware, servers and storage Minimum of 3 years of Report Program Generator (RPG) development, including: RPGIV, RPG ILE, RPG Free, and SQL ILE. Additional years’ experience required for level 3. Minimum of 3 years of CL and CLLE languages. Additional years’ experience required for level 3. Minimum of 3 years of technical working experience with DB2 and SQL databases. Additional years’ experience required for level 3. Minimum of 3 years of technical working experience with iSeries security, administration. Additional years’ experience required for level 3.
